Why microRNA Is Becoming the Center of Attention

MicroRNAs are short, non-coding RNA molecules.
They don’t create proteins, but they control how genes behave.

That control is powerful.
When something goes wrong at the genetic level, microRNAs often sit at the center of the problem.

Researchers now see them as both:

  • Disease indicators

  • Therapeutic targets

This dual role makes microRNA highly valuable in modern medicine.

Diagnostics Are Getting Smarter, Faster, and Less Invasive

One of the biggest advantages of microRNA is how easily it can be detected.
It exists in blood, tissue, and other body fluids.

This opens doors to non-invasive diagnostics.
Patients no longer need complex or painful procedures for early detection.

Modern diagnostic systems now use microRNA for:

  • Early cancer detection

  • Disease progression tracking

  • Personalized treatment planning

The Challenges No One Can Ignore

Despite the excitement, the microRNA market faces serious hurdles.

Delivering microRNA-based therapies safely remains complex.
These molecules can degrade quickly in the bloodstream.

There are also concerns about:

  • Off-target effects

  • Unintended gene silencing

  • Toxicity in biological systems

Precision is both the strength and the challenge of microRNA.
A slight mismatch can lead to unexpected outcomes.

This is why regulatory approval and large-scale adoption still require time.

Services Are Quietly Leading the Market

Interestingly, the services segment holds the largest share.

MicroRNA research requires specialized processes like sequencing, analysis, and data interpretation.
Many organizations prefer outsourcing these complex tasks.

Service providers offer end-to-end solutions, including:

  • Sample preparation

  • Sequencing

  • Bioinformatics analysis

  • Data reporting

This makes advanced research accessible even to smaller companies.
